Output 00d4d8604b38f41799de9377b486f024e6863371ab3203d0a205d7ae6f402996:3

value
9321838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d58d2234fcb28df54b760b246847115808bd779e OP_EQUAL
address
3MAAvYFFMNhEQcb7EyasEfWvbcRZN5Km7J
transaction
00d4d8604b38f41799de9377b486f024e6863371ab3203d0a205d7ae6f402996
confirmations
283922
spent
true